Background
The gas-liquid hydraulic machine is a device which utilizes a gas-liquid pressure cylinder as a power output device, has very wide types and functions, can replace the traditional mechanical stamping hydraulic machine, and is widely applied to: stamping, bending, cutting, punching, impressing, riveting, metal plate reshaping, tight assembly, extrusion die forming, profile butt welding, material test and the like;
the hydraulic machine with a good buffering effect comprises a hydraulic machine workbench, a hydraulic rod and an oil cylinder, wherein a positioning rod is arranged at the top of the hydraulic machine workbench, a pressing plate is arranged outside the positioning rod, a third spring is connected between the pressing plate and the hydraulic machine workbench in a transmission manner, a buffering mechanism is fixedly arranged outside the pressing plate through an installation mechanism, a mold is arranged at the top of the hydraulic machine workbench, and a rotating shaft is fixedly sleeved inside the hydraulic machine workbench; through setting up No. three springs, bracing piece, fixed cover, No. two fixed covers, a spring and No. two springs, can utilize the elastic deformation of three spring to reduce the ram pressure degree in the use of hydraulic press, avoided because of hydraulic press buffering effect is poor for hydraulic press ram pressure degree is too big and lead to the problem that the hydraulic press workstation takes place to damage, thereby makes the buffering effect of hydraulic press better.

Referring to fig. 1 and 5, the utility model provides a technical solution: a gas-liquid hydraulic machine with a display angle adjustable function, comprising: the hydraulic machine comprises a hydraulic machine body 1 and a workbench 2, wherein the bottom end surface of the hydraulic machine body 1 is connected with the workbench 2;
the mounting plate 3 is connected to one side surface of the main body 1 of the gas-liquid hydraulic machine, the surface of the mounting plate 3 is connected with a liquid crystal display controller 4, the side surface of the liquid crystal display controller 4, which is attached to the mounting plate 3, is vertically connected with a connecting shaft 5, one end of the connecting shaft 5, which is far away from the liquid crystal display controller 4, is connected with a transmission gear 6, the inside of the mounting plate 3 is connected with an adjusting screw rod 7 in a penetrating way, through the structure, the adjusting screw rod 7 can be rotated, the adjusting screw rod 7 can rotate and slide in the inside of the mounting plate 3, meanwhile, the transmission gear 6 is driven to rotate, the liquid crystal display controller 4 is driven to rotate through the rotation of the transmission gear 6, so that the purpose of adjusting the display angle of the liquid crystal display controller 4 is achieved, the liquid crystal display controller 4 is in rotating connection with the mounting plate 3 through the connecting shaft 5, and the liquid crystal display controller 4 is connected with the transmission gear 6 through the connecting shaft 5, through the structure, the transmission gear 6 can drive the liquid crystal display controller 4 to rotate, the adjusting screw rod 7 is in threaded connection with the mounting plate 3, a gear meshing connection structure is formed between the adjusting screw rod 7 and the transmission gear 6, and the adjusting screw rod 7 is rotated through the structure so as to drive the transmission gear 6 to rotate.
The work table 2 includes: the supporting lugs 8 are vertically connected to the surface of the workbench 2, the connecting screw rod 9 is connected inside the supporting lugs 8 in a penetrating manner, one end of the connecting screw rod 9 is connected with a turntable 10 so that the connecting screw rod 9 can rotate, one end of the connecting screw rod 9, which is far away from the turntable 10, is connected with a rotating block 11, the rotating block 11 is arranged inside a clamping plate 12, workpieces to be processed are placed on the surface of the workbench 2, the turntable 10 is rotated again, the turntable 10 drives the connecting screw rod 9 to rotate, through threaded connection between the connecting screw rod 9 and the supporting lugs 8 and rotating connection between the connecting screw rod 9 and the clamping plate 12, the two groups of clamping plates 12 can move oppositely, so that two ends of the workpieces placed on the surface of the workbench 2 are clamped, the purpose of fixing the workpieces is achieved, the workpieces are prevented from deviating, the supporting lugs 8 are provided with two groups, the two groups of supporting lugs 8 are symmetrically distributed about a longitudinal middle distribution line of the workbench 2, so as to clamp two ends of a workpiece, the connecting screw rod 9 is in threaded connection with the supporting lug 8, and the connecting screw rod 9 is in rotary connection with the clamping plate 12 through the rotating block 11, so that the clamping plates 12 can slide in opposite directions or opposite directions.
The working principle and the beneficial effects of the embodiment are that when the gas-liquid hydraulic press with the function of displaying angle adjustability is used, firstly, a workpiece to be processed is placed on the surface of the workbench 2, then the turntable 10 is rotated, the turntable 10 drives the connecting screw rod 9 to rotate, the workpiece is fixed by the threaded connection between the connecting screw rod 9 and the supporting lug 8 and the rotating connection between the connecting screw rod 9 and the clamping plates 12, so that the two groups of clamping plates 12 can move oppositely, the two ends of the workpiece placed on the surface of the workbench 2 are clamped, the purpose of fixing the workpiece is achieved, the workpiece is prevented from deviating, the adjusting screw rod 7 can rotate and slide in the mounting plate 3 while rotating, the transmission teeth 6 are driven to rotate, and the liquid crystal display controller 4 is driven to rotate by the rotation of the transmission teeth 6, thereby achieving the purpose of adjusting the display angle of the lcd controller 4, and the contents not described in detail in this specification belong to the prior art well known to those skilled in the art.
